I customized a lot of stuff in 2.3 about a year ago. I'm in the process of upgrading to 2.8 right now. I keep everything in TFS so to do it I:
-Download 2.8 from CodePlex and create a new folder next to my normal one in TFS -Do a baseless merge from my custom version to 2.8, this requires using the diff tool to resolve any conflicks -Open the merged solution and go through and fix the errors that were missed in the merge.
It's definitely a pain. If it's possible to make your changes through a plugin in the future, I would do that. It's not always an option, though.
